Battery packs in electric go-carts need to last a fairly long time. The run-times (time until it needs to be recharged) of the b
pav-90 [236]

Answer:

The minimum level for which the battery pack will be classified as highly sought-after class is 2.42 hours

Step-by-step explanation:

Problems of normally distributed samples are solved using the z-score formula.

In a set with mean \mu and standard deviation \sigma, the zscore of a measure X is given by:

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}

The Z-score measures how many standard deviations the measure is from the mean. After finding the Z-score, we look at the z-score table and find the p-value associated with this z-score. This p-value is the probability that the value of the measure is smaller than X, that is, the percentile of X. Subtracting 1 by the pvalue, we get the probability that the value of the measure is greater than X.

In this problem, we have that:

\mu = 2, \sigma = 0.33

What is the minimum level for which the battery pack will be classified as highly sought-after class

At least the 100-10 = 90th percentile, which is the value of X when Z has a pvalue of 0.9. So it is X when Z = 1.28.

Z = \frac{X - \mu}{\sigma}

1.28 = \frac{X - 2}{0.33}

X - 2 = 0.33*1.28

X = 2.42

The minimum level for which the battery pack will be classified as highly sought-after class is 2.42 hours
